Darley Drive is in Liverpool and in Liverpool district. L12 8QR is located in the West Derby Leyfield elect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Liverpool, West Derby.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Darley Drive was 101.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 3.0% lower than the Sandfield Park average. The most reported crime type was Shoplifting.
Darley Drive has the 9th highest crime rate of 31 local areas in Sandfield Park and the 651st highest crime rate of 1,559 local areas in Liverpool .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 32.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-28.7%.
